    How to run: Step one, desire to run. Write what you say you want, and write the reasons why, and ask why for those reasons too until you hit the base reason… and be sure by asking why to that too. You cannot force yourself to want to run. Tape up the reason, easily readable, somewhere so you don’t lose sight. Step two, look at where you want to go. Write it down. Be specific. Now make it even more specific. Break the distance into smaller stretches with landmarks in the park, so you’ll know how far you’ve ran and how long it took. This is your roadmap. Review it every morning and night so you can track your progress. Something might move in the way, and you might have to change your path or even destination, but without having that destination in the first place, you’ll never know where to go. It’s unwise to fire an arrow without having a target painted. Step three, grab something to pull you up to stand. You’ve never done this before, so don’t trick yourself by thinking you’ll start off as a marathon or sprinting champion. That’ll only demoralize you. Grab onto any old park bench, your simple introduction to the complex craft of running. Step four, observe what happens when you move your legs. Use your eyes and mind and sponge-absorb what happens, and try to figure out why they happen like that. Step five, take a step. It’s okay if you fall, falling just shows you a new method and its result. Write down why you fell so you can refer to it when you try again. Figure out new techniques and play and test things out while you walk towards your destination. You’ll fall down a lot, wobble, and flail like a dolphin-chicken, but write what went wrong and get back up. When you get frustrated and you can’t understand why things aren’t working, take a break and get plenty of sleep. Then think about what was going wrong and maybe even ask a fitness coach about it. Ask multiple fitness coaches! Sometimes things just don’t “click” until you hear the right wording. Step six, review the reason you started this. You’ve taped it up where you’ll see it every day, right? Make sure you’re looking at your roadmap often too. Don’t spend that effort getting your sight only to close your eyes. Step seven, start to run. All the while, enjoy the journey! A doggo doesn’t take a car ride to go to a destination, he gets excited to go on a car ride because of the sights and wind.
